Medicare Basics

Original Medicare is offered by the US government to folks who are over the age of 65 or under 65 and on are handicap. Medicare is made up of Parts A and B. Part A covers hospital insurance and Part B covers doctor visits and outpatient services. Normally, Medicare covers 80 percent of the bill so there’s 20% left combined with various deductibles copays and coinsurances. Due to these openings left over many people decide to get a Medicare Supplement Plan to pay what Medicare doesn’t fully pay for, these programs are also known as Medigap plans.

Medigap Explained

The hottest Medicare supplement plans are plans F, G, & N. Because the plans are standardized and the benefits are regulated by the US government there’s no gap in policy between companies for the specific same plan. By way of instance, Medigap plan G is exactly the same whether it is offered by Mutual of Omaha, Aetna, Cigna, or any other insurance company. In any given state from the U.S. you will find about 30 or more companies offering these programs, each at a different cost.

With almost any standardized Medigap insurance plan you can see any doctor anywhere in the country that accepts Medicare, no referrals needed. Additionally plans F, N and G have a restricted foreign travel coverage that’s beneficial for those folks May traveling beyond the country.

Also, it’s essential to be aware that prescription coverage is not offered on any standardized Medicare Supplement Plan, it’s covered under a separate program referred to as part D.

These plans are also guaranteed-renewable for life, premiums cannot be increased as a result of health or canceled due to health.

Supplemental Medigap Plan N

Medicare Supplement Plan N is the most affordable of the three . Plan N is similar to insurance plan G, except the following out-of-pocket expenses on Plan N:

$0-$20 office visit copay
$50 at the emergency room (waived if admitted)
Part B excess charges aren’t covered

Plan N is a possible great match for someone who does not see the doctor on a regular basis, this person would not incur the office visit copay each time they see the physician. If you’re wanting to save some premium dollars Plan N may be good fit for you.

When Is The Optimal Time To Purchase A Plan?

The ideal time to buy a Medigap plan is whenever you’re new to Medicare, either turning 65 or starting Medicare Part B for the first time. The main reason this is the very best time is this is regarded as “Open enrollment” and may purchase any plan you need, no health underwriting is required.

If you are purchasing plan out of “open enrollment” you may have to answer health questions and also be subject to health underwriting to get approved. It is possible that you can be turned down.
